Paul Smith isn’t just one person in the public eye. The name belongs to a globally celebrated British fashion designer, an English indie frontman, and a veteran Contemporary Christian singer—all active at mid-decade 2025. That overlap can confuse readers and search engines alike. This mid-decade study separates their careers, earnings engines, and obligations, with the designer’s wealth the clear outlier. It matters because misattribution can distort earnings estimates, dilute brand value, and skew comparables across fashion and music.


Quick-ID: Which Paul Smith Is Which? (Mid-Decade 2025)

PersonFieldBornBest Known ForMid-Decade Status
Sir Paul Smith (Fashion Designer)Fashion1946Independent menswear house, classic tailoring with playful detailsEstimated ~$400 million net worth; global business facing cost pressures and selective growth
Paul Smith (English Singer/Songwriter)Indie Music1979Lead vocalist of Maxïmo ParkActive touring/recording; album cycle in 2024–2025; earnings typical for veteran UK indie acts
Paul Charles Smith (CCM)Christian/Gospel1953The Imperials; solo CCMCatalog/royalties/speaking/worship work; income more modest and project-based

Sir Paul Smith (Fashion Designer): Mid-Decade 2025 Financial Overview

Sir Paul’s wealth stems from a 50-plus-year brand built on independent control, disciplined expansion, and collaborations (from cars to cultural institutions). The brand’s retail remains resilient, but wholesale and macro headwinds (inflation, geopolitics, tourist VAT changes) have pressured profits. Recent filings highlight the tension: top-line growth yet recurring pre-tax losses, prompting selective property and cost actions. Mid-decade reality: he remains wealthy due to accumulated ownership, licensing, property interests, and cash flow over decades—even as near-term profitability fluctuates.

Why the Net Worth Still Screens High

  • Time in market: Five decades of compounding founder equity and royalties.
  • Independent control: Ability to pivot without the overheads of a conglomerate.
  • Enduring brand codes: Tailoring, stripes, and wit translating across seasons and geographies.

Mid-Decade Take: Even with recent losses, the founder’s personal wealth reflects historical cash flows, licensing economics, and the value of a still-global label. Expect disciplined growth (flagship-first, collaboration-led) while cost control and property optimization manage downside. Net worth around $400 million remains a reasonable mid-decade anchor.


Paul Smith (English Singer, Maxïmo Park): Career & Earnings Snapshot

Income Sources (Music, 2025)

IncomeDriver2025 Reality
Recording (Band/Solo)Streaming, physical, publishingModest but steady catalogue streaming; spikes during release cycles
TouringTickets + merchPrimary cash engine; profitable routing and festivals matter
Publishing/SyncWriting credits, occasional placementsLumpy; improves with media tie-ins
Books/Guest FeaturesSide projects, features, talksSupplementary; brand-building more than core income

Cost Considerations: Tour production, crew, transport, management (≈15–20%), agent (≈10%), taxes (UK progressive rates + NI), and living costs. A veteran UK indie act typically optimizes efficient touring and merch. Net worth is not publicly disclosed mid-decade; industry-typical ranges for such artists are far below celebrity fashion fortunes and vary widely by catalogue/publishing splits and touring cadence.

Mid-Decade 2025: Why This Differentiation Matters

  1. Search & brand accuracy: Confusing the designer with the musicians can inflate or deflate perceived wealth and influence.
  2. Comparable sets: Fashion multiples (brand equity, retail productivity) aren’t comparable to indie touring economics or CCM ministry models.
  3. Risk profiles: The designer navigates currency, rents, and wholesale cycles; the indie singer manages tour risk and streaming realities; the CCM artist balances event demand with catalogue longevity.
